Basil Balsamic Marinated Tofu

Basil Balsamic Marinated Tofu is a protein-packed tofu dish that features fresh summer basil. This maple syrup and balsamic marinated tofu has a rich flavor with just six ingredients!

Prep Time 1 hour
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 10 minutes
Servings 4

Ingredients

  • 1 14 Ounce Block Extra Firm Tofu
  • ½ Cup Julienned Basil divided
  • ¼ Cup Balsamic Vinegar
  • 2 Tablespoons Maple Syrup
  • 1 Tablespoon Soy Sauce Tamari, or Liquid Aminos
  • 3 Cloves Garlic minced
  • ¼ Teaspoon Black Pepper
  • To Serve: cooked rice pasta, etc.

Instructions

  • Press the tofu. Wrap each block of tofu in paper towels and place under a heavy object to release extra liquid. Let sit for 20-30 minutes.
  • In a small bowl whisk together ¼ cup of the basil, the balsamic vinegar, maple syrup, soy sauce, garlic, and pepper.
  • Slice the tofu into ½" cubes.
  • Place the tofu in a shallow dish and pour the marinade over the tofu. Let marinate at least 30 minutes. Stir once or twice to ensure all the tofu is covered.
  • Heat a large non-stick pan over medium heat. Add the tofu and any extra marinade liquid and cook for 7-8 minutes, stirring occasionally until the tofu is browned on all sides.
  • Serve with the remaining basil. Enjoy!

Notes

Baking Instructions
  1. Preheat the oven to 450°F and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. Follow steps 2-4 as written above.
  3. Pour the tofu and marinade on the baking sheet and bake for 30-40 minutes, stirring halfway through.
  4. Serve with the remaining basil. Enjoy!
